Compare all specifications:
2004 Audi A8 | 1970 Subaru FF-1 | |
Make | Audi | Subaru |
Model | A8 | FF-1 |
Year Released | 2004 | 1970 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 3935 cc | 1267 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| boxer |
Horse Power | 271 HP | 93 HP |
Engine RPM | 3750 RPM | 7000 RPM |
Torque | 650 Nm | 103 Nm |
Torque RPM | 1800 RPM | 5000 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 81 mm | 82 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 95.5 mm | 60 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 18.0:1 | 10.0:1 |
Top Speed | 250 km/hour | 170 km/hour |
Drive Type | 4WD | Front |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Vehicle Weight | 1940 kg | 760 kg |
Vehicle Length | 5060 mm | 3910 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1900 mm | 1490 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1450 mm | 1380 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2950 mm | 2430 mm |
